在当今数字化时代,拥有一个属于自己的网站已经成为了企业和个人展示自我、拓展业务的重要方式之一,而为了让网站能够被全球用户轻松访问,我们需要将域名与网页服务器进行正确地绑定,本文将详细阐述如何实现这一过程,确保您的网站能够高效运行并受到用户的喜爱。
了解基本概念
- 域名:域名是互联网上用于识别和定位计算机的一个文本标识符,例如www.example.com,它使得人们可以通过输入该地址来访问相应的网站或服务。
- 网页服务器:网页服务器是指负责处理客户端请求并提供相应响应的服务器软件或硬件设备,常见的网页服务器包括Apache、Nginx等。
- DNS解析:DNS(Domain Name System)是一种分布式数据库系统,用于将域名转换为IP地址的过程称为DNS解析,当用户在浏览器中输入一个域名时,DNS会将此域名翻译为对应的IP地址,以便于网络通信。
准备工作
在进行域名绑定之前,您需要完成以下准备工作:
- 购买合适的域名并注册到域名管理平台;
- 选择一家可靠的网页托管商以获得稳定的带宽和服务质量;
- 安装必要的网页服务器软件并在本地环境中测试其功能。
配置DNS记录
为了使域名指向正确的网页服务器,需要在域名提供商那里创建相应的DNS记录,通常情况下,这涉及到以下几个步骤:
- 登录到您的域名控制面板;
- 找到“DNS设置”或类似选项卡;
- 新建一条A记录(若使用IPv4),或将现有A记录更新为目标服务器的IP地址;对于IPv6环境,则应使用AAAA记录替换A记录;
- 保存更改并等待DNS缓存刷新时间结束。
不同域名提供商可能具有不同的界面设计和操作流程,因此具体操作步骤可能会略有差异,如果您遇到困难,建议查阅官方文档或者联系技术支持获取帮助。
调整网页服务器配置文件
一旦DNS记录生效后,接下来就需要对网页服务器进行一些基本的配置工作,以下是针对几种常见类型的服务器的简要说明:
图片来源于网络,如有侵权联系删除
Apache
- 打开httpd.conf文件(默认位于/etc/httpd/conf/目录下);
- 查找ServerName行并将其设置为您的域名;
- 如果启用了虚拟主机功能,还需要添加一行VirtualHost指令来指定虚拟主机的IP地址和端口信息;
- 重启Apache服务以应用新的配置。
Nginx
- 编辑nginx.conf文件(通常存放在/usr/local/nginx/conf/路径内);
- 在server块中加入location / { return 301 https://$host$request_uri; } 这条语句强制所有HTTP请求跳转到HTTPS版本;
- 对于非根目录站点,可以在location块中使用root指令指定静态文件的存放位置;
- 最后不要忘记重启Nginx进程!
其他服务器
除了上述两种主流选择外,还有许多其他类型的网页服务器可供选择,如IIS、Lighttpd等,它们的配置方法各有特点,但总体而言都遵循类似的逻辑——通过修改相关配置文件来实现特定功能的定制化需求。
安全考虑
随着网络安全威胁的不断升级,保护网站免受恶意攻击显得尤为重要,以下是一些增强网站安全性的一般性建议:
- 使用SSL/TLS证书加密数据传输;
- 定期检查并及时修复已知的漏洞和安全问题;
- 实施强大的密码策略和使用双因素认证机制;
- 监控流量和行为模式以检测潜在的入侵尝试。
持续优化和维护
即使完成了所有的前期工作和初步部署,也不能认为大功告成,相反,应该始终保持警惕并进行持续的监控和分析,定期评估性能指标、用户反馈以及市场趋势等因素可以帮助我们及时发现潜在问题并提出改进措施。
图片来源于网络,如有侵权联系删除
要想成功地将域名与网页服务器进行有效绑定并非易事,它需要对各种技术和工具有深入的了解和实践经验的支持,然而只要掌握了正确的技巧和方法,相信每一位开发者都能轻松应对这项挑战并为用户提供更加优质的服务体验!
标签: #网页服务器 绑定域名
评论列表